Riley Clemmons teams up with Brett Young for “Godsend” duet

Rising artist Riley Clemmons has teamed up with multi-platinum recording artist Brett Young for a very special duet version of “Godsend.” With vocals laced with emotion, the introspective song contemplates the idea that everything happens for a reason and that every negative thing was an opportunity for growth. The addition of Brett’s voice woven with Riley’s provides a new perspective that while life can seem isolating, others go through similar struggles. Listen to “Godsend feat. Bret Young » HERE. “Brett has always been one of my favorite musical storytellers,” Riley shares. “It’s a true honor to have his voice and unique perspective tell the story of ‘Godsend’ on this new release.” » About working with Riley, Brett said, “The first time I heard that song, it really moved me and I was honored when I was asked to be a part of it. I’m a huge fan of Riley and can’t wait to see what else she does next. “Feat of God. Brett Young” comes from the deluxe version of Riley’s second album of the same name. Since its release, Godsend has garnered nearly 200 million streams worldwide and produced several top 20 singles, cementing Riley’s position as an artist to watch. She was named one of the “Emerging artists 2021, punctuated a partnership with Vevo and performed at MusiCares x The Amy Winehouse Foundation’s Benefit “Back To Amy” to support mental health awareness. She continues her rise in the fall with performances on the SHEIN X ROCK THE RUNWAY virtual fashion show, the TODAY ShowAnd FOX and friends. This summer, Riley will make her European debut with performances in London and the Netherlands. Riley Clemmons is a 22-year-old artist from Nashville, TN who has amassed nearly 250 million global streams and 50 million YouTube video views during her young career. After spending years honing her craft in writers’ rooms, Riley skyrocketed onto the scene with her debut single “Broken Prayers” from Capitol CMG in 2017, which has generated over 30 million global streams to date. day. Her 2018 self-titled debut album quickly entered the Billboard Heatseekers chart, entering at No. 13. Her sophomore album, Godsend, solidified Riley’s position as an artist and has garnered over 194 million global streams since its release. exit. An accomplished composer, performer, producer and artist, Riley draws inspiration from life’s experiences, blending musical influences ranging from pop to classic rock to create music that is as catchy as it is relatable.
